**Portland Hospital**

**Working hours - 37.5 per week, Monday - Friday 9am - 5:30pm (flexibility required, including early mornings and evenings)**

**Salary - £27,000 - £39,300 per annum (depending on experience)**

An excellent opportunity has arisen for an MDT Lead to join the Portland Hospital for Women and Children. The role of the Lead will be to support the growth and development of all the MDTs across the Portland Hospital to ensure that we are aligned to National Standards and accessible to all consultants practising within the hospital.

**Duties & Responsibilities**
- Administer and support the MDT’s across the Portland to ensure all consultants have access to appropriate MDT’s for patients
- To ensure all documentation is accurate and complies with HCA MDT guidelines and to take notes at the meetings
- Assist with facilitation of cover across the Governance team where needed
- Support with data imputing for national databases
- Ensure the facility accesses the MDT for the specialism in a timely manner by influencing clinical staff to utilise all available MDT’s
- Facilitate effective communication across sites building trust and co-operation from the diverse workforce groups
- Promote a positive learning environment where changes are established and embedded to improve patient safety, experience and outcomes
- Lead on lessons learned taking appropriate action and response to mistakes or service failures and ensuring an open learning culture is fostered
- Perform audit analysis to ensure all MDTs are performing, collating reports of audit findings, implement action plans and review
- Foster trusting relationships with external stakeholders including consultants and Medical Secretaries

**Skills & Experience**
- Substantial experience working as an MDT Coordinator
- Excellent word/excel/powepoint experience
-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al
- Experience of multi professional working
